Pushkar Singh Dhami took oath as Uttarakhand CM for the second time. Eight other ministers also took oath of office in presence of PM Modi and several senior BJP leaders. He was brought in as CM in July last year after the resignation of Tirath Singh Rawat. Although Dhami himself lost the polls from Khatima, the party high command decided to let him continue as CM. Now, Dhami will have to be elected as MLA within six months.
